Output efc89d0c11c4b2d7f3021ecdac89bb04f5d7d16527724945ba8b156ea661c711:4

value
3792355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9c35e0078a28e5d50917ac1affe9bb484015c9e OP_EQUAL
address
3HAeAK9jFY3QvgWaX12mEG5qH563KxJVWQ
transaction
efc89d0c11c4b2d7f3021ecdac89bb04f5d7d16527724945ba8b156ea661c711
spent
true